Adecco US, Inc. 3rd Shift Electrical Maintenance Mechanic in Hazle Township, Pennsylvania

ELECTRICAL MAINTENANCE MECHANIC

Hazleton PA

3 rd Shift - Midnight to 8am

A leader in the industrial packaging industry, is accepting resumes for full-time Electrical Maintenance Mechanics at our Hazleton, PA facility. We are looking for motivated individuals who can perform a multitude of functions in a flexible, fast-paced production environment. Our workplace requires individuals who understand the needs of the business while maintaining a focus on safety, customer satisfaction, quality, and productivity. Specific responsibilities include preventative maintenance, breakdown repairs, minimize equipment down time and perform small project activities. The position will require working in a multitasking role with other maintenance mechanics and electricians to complete any given task.

Prior to initiating employment, all candidates considered for employment will be required to pass a skilled trades assessment, participate in a panel interview, background check and physical/drug testing. Hourly rate range is $33.48 per hour and overtime.

We offer an excellent benefits package that includes medical, dental, life insurance, pension plan and a 401(k). This a great opportunity to start a career with a dynamic and proven manufacturer in the packaging industry.

Specific responsibilities include but are not limited to:

• Following all safety rules and practices.

• Performing preventive maintenance activities such as lubricating, measuring wear, measuring positions, repositioning components; and observing operations, vibrations, and noise levels.

• Performing emergency / break down maintenance as necessary to support plant operations.

• Accurately using measurement and test equipment.

• Performing electrical up to 480v, mechanical, pneumatic, hydraulic, steam system, and other repairs and installations as needed.

• Maintaining clean and organized work areas and cleaning up work areas as part of completing assigned tasks.

• Accurately and completely prepare and maintain maintenance records and other paperwork.

• Troubleshooting and solving problems.

• Excellent teamwork, cooperation, and problem-solving skills.

• Willingness to fully cross train in other technical areas to enhance capabilities.

• Candidates must be willing to work alternative shifts, weekends, and overtime as required.

• Able to work with computer system for maintenance processes, stores, and work orders.

• Performing other duties as assigned by supervision.

Competencies include:

• Mechanical aptitude

• Troubleshooting expertise

• Electrical knowledge

Minimum qualifications include but are not limited to:

A high school degree (preferred), and at least one year of successful mechanical and electrical/electronic troubleshooting and repair experience in a manufacturing facility. Highly qualified candidates would possess manufacturing experience in the corrugated industry.

• On-the-job success in safety, attendance and quality of work expected.

• Maintenance experience in corrugated a plus. Strong knowledgeable of lubrication, hydraulics, welding, pneumatics, electrical and electronics technologies.

• Excellent teamwork, cooperation and problem-solving skills.

• Willingness to cross train in other technical areas to enhance capabilities.

• Willing and able to work any shift, call-ins, holidays, and overtime as there is a constant demand for overtime in our maintenance department.

• Able to work with computer system for maintenance processes, stores, and work orders.
